在互联网世界中,当我们在浏览器中点击一个链接或者输入一个网址时,我们期望能够顺利地访问到所需的网页内容。然而,有时我们可能会遇到一个名为"404 Not Found"的错误页面。这时,我们通常会感到困惑和失望,因为我们无法找到我们所需要的网页。
那么什么是"404 Not Found"呢?为什么会出现这个错误页面?如何应对和解决这个问题呢?在本文中,我们将通过详细的解释和举例,深入探讨"404 Not Found"的含义、原因和解决方法。
首先,让我们来解释一下"404 Not Found"的含义。"404"是指一个HTTP状态码,用于表示请求的资源不存在。而"Not Found"则是对该状态码的简单描述。当我们在浏览器中访问一个网页时,服务器会返回一个HTTP响应状态码。通常情况下,我们希望服务器返回的是"200 OK"状态码,表示请求成功。然而,当服务器无法找到所请求的资源时,就会返回"404 Not Found"状态码。
那么为什么会出现"404 Not Found"错误页面呢?造成这个错误的原因有很多种,下面列举了几个常见的情况。
1. 页面被删除或被重命名:有时网站管理员会删除或重命名一个页面,但忘记更新其他页面中的链接。当用户点击这个旧链接时,服务器没有找到相应的资源,就会返回"404 Not Found"错误页面。
2. 链接输入错误:用户在浏览器中输入网址时,可能会出现拼写错误或者误输入的情况。这也会导致服务器无法找到所请求的资源,返回"404 Not Found"错误页面。
3. 服务器配置问题:有时服务器的配置可能存在问题,导致无法正确地处理某些请求。这可能是因为服务器软件的错误配置,或者是服务器上的文件丢失或损坏。
4. 网站重定向问题:有时网站会进行重定向,将一个页面的URL指向另一个页面。如果重定向设置不正确,或者目标页面不存在,就会导致"404 Not Found"错误。
无论是哪种原因导致的"404 Not Found"错误,我们都希望能够及时解决这个问题。下面是一些常用的解决方法。
1. 检查链接是否正确:首先,我们需要检查所访问的链接是否拼写正确,是否存在输入错误。有时候只是一个简单的拼写错误就会导致"404 Not Found"错误。
2. 刷新页面:有时服务器可能会出现暂时的问题,导致资源无法访问。在这种情